Summary
Lymphoma in acquired immunodeficiency syndrome (AIDS) often affects sites outside lymph nodes and progresses aggressively. This case highlights probable multifocal extra-nodal non-Hodgkin

Background:
- Acquired immunodeficiency syndrome (AIDS) significantly alters immune function.
- Lymphoma is a common malignancy in individuals with AIDS.
- Extra-nodal lymphoma in AIDS patients presents unique clinical challenges.
Observation:
- A case of extra-nodal non-Hodgkin's lymphoma (NHL) in an AIDS patient is presented.
- The lymphoma showed probable multifocal involvement.
- Clinical presentation suggests aggressive disease course.
Findings:
- Extra-nodal NHL in AIDS is characterized by aggressive histology.
- Frequent involvement of sites beyond lymph nodes is typical.
- Multifocal presentation indicates widespread disease.
Implications:
- Early recognition and aggressive management are crucial for extra-nodal NHL in AIDS.
- Understanding the behavior of lymphoma in immunocompromised individuals is vital.
- Further research into the pathogenesis and treatment of AIDS-related lymphoma is warranted.

Primary Lymphoid Organs
Primary lymphoid organs are pivotal in the formation, development, and maturation of lymphocytes, the white blood cells that serve as the backbone of our immune system. This crucial function underscores their fundamental role in maintaining our overall health and immunity. The two primary lymphoid organs of prime importance are the red bone marrow and the thymus.

Sexually Transmitted Infections
Sexually transmitted infections (STIs) are diseases transmitted primarily through unsafe sexual interactions. Bacteria, viruses, or parasites cause them and can result in severe health complications if untreated.ChlamydiaThe bacterium Chlamydia trachomatis is responsible for the disease Chlamydia, the most common STI in the United States. Immunodeficiency Diseases
Immunodeficiency disorders are conditions in which the immune system's ability to fight infectious disease and cancer is compromised or entirely absent. The immune system comprises a complex network of cells, tissues, and organs that work together to protect the body from potentially harmful invaders. When this system is deficient or not functioning properly, it leaves the body susceptible to infections, diseases, or other complications.
